What is Bunny Flags?
Bunny Flags is a tower defense and action shooter game developed by Cuatic Games, where you protect your flag from waves of enemies.
How do you play Bunny Flags?
In Bunny Flags, you control a bunny character, build different types of turrets, and strategically place barricades to defend your flag while shooting incoming enemies yourself.
What kind of upgrades are available in Bunny Flags?
Bunny Flags features a progression system where you can earn experience, unlock new skills, and upgrade your bunny's abilities as you progress through levels.
Are there different enemy types in Bunny Flags?
Yes, Bunny Flags includes various enemy types, each with unique behaviors and abilities that require different defensive strategies.
On which platforms can you play Bunny Flags?
Bunny Flags is a browser-based game that can be played on the Kongregate website, making it accessible on most computers with an internet connection.
